Default Rear Turn Signal Problem

My 2003 XJ8 rear left turn signal started giving the faster click sound so I thought my directional bulb was blown. I changed out the bulb and it's still not working and the car thinks the bulb is blown. I've tried switching the panels to see if it was a bad connection at the bulb. Same issue. I also tried splicing a wire to a ground to see if it could be a bad ground. I used the black wire from the harness - this did not work either. Can't seem to find a solution. Any thoughts? I'm sure I can fix this myself if I knew where to look. Thanks in advance for any help. - ANTXJ

Sorry, these car don't have a turn signal relay; they are controlled by the body processor. You said you replaced the bulb, did you install a single element or double element bulb?? It should be a single. A double element bulb will fire a bulb failure and fast flash.

Maybe...... but there are a couple of things you could try to check. The LR signal circuit is a Green/White wire the goes through two large 54 position connectors on the way from the body processor, which is in front of the glove box.
One is in the boot, above the gas tank about 8 inches to the left of the RH boot lid hinge. It has a bail of sorts that lifts to release the connector. You could check it and see if anything turns up. There is another one just like it at the right side of the fascia just below the A/C vent. You will need to remove the glove box to access it. Worth a try.

Hey Steve, Thought you may want to know, I checked in the boot area described. All I did was move the felt surround near the antenna and moved some wires around and voila the blinker and hazards now work fine. These cars have a mind of their own! LOL
